How accurate do you think Touring Plans room categories are with Pop Century in regards to Standard room locations vs Preferred room locations now?
 
Unless the sections that are Standard or Preferred have changed, there shouldn't be a problem. Pop's have always been pretty accurate on there.
 
I'd say pretty accurate. The buildings listed as preferred based on room type/bed, make sense to me with some caveat on bldg 10 depending what side you're on. Short walk to lobby, pool, food and skyliner. Maybe they're not the closest to the parking lots but otherwise, they all fit the bill. I don't find Pop to be super huge so I've never picked preferred but I know sometimes that's the only booking category left at times.

I was thinking surely so. There's a whole lot more Standard view rooms there than any other category.
 

TP is accurate but I really recommend considering Preferred at Pop. That walk back to the far corner of the 90s section at the end of the day from the skyliner is brutal
